dataslots==1.2.0
pyserial-asyncio==0.6
typing-extensions<5.0,>=4.14.0

[dev]
pyplumio[docs,test]
pre-commit==4.2.0
tomli==2.2.1

[docs]
sphinx==8.1.3
sphinx_rtd_theme==3.0.2
readthedocs-sphinx-search==0.3.2

[test]
codespell==2.4.1
coverage==7.9.1
freezegun==1.5.2
mypy==1.16.1
numpy<3.0.0,>=2.0.0
pyserial-asyncio-fast==0.16
pytest==8.4.1
pytest-asyncio==1.0.0
ruff==0.12.1
tox==4.27.0
types-pyserial==3.5.0.20250326
